Abstract High time resolution measurements of Earth rotation and atmospheric angular momentum (AAM) and their interpretation have been proposed as a major research thrust for the 1990s. An extensive campaign, SEARCH'92, is now under way to obtain these measurements utilizing all space geodetic techniques and to collect the best available complementary geophysical, oceanographic and atmospheric data. This paper discusses its motivation and scientific benefits and reviews international cooperation in several measurement campaigns with particular emphasis on SEARCH'92. Recent analysis results are highlighted.
